Understanding Casino Licensing and Regulation
One of the most critical aspects of choosing an online casino is verifying its legitimacy through licensing and regulation. A reputable online casino will be licensed by a recognized gaming authority,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C), or the Kahnawake Gaming Commission. These authorities impose strict standards for fairness, security, and responsible gambling practices. Without a valid license, a casino operates in a gray area, and players have little recourse in case of disputes or unfair practices. Players should always check for the licensing information displayed on the casino's website, usually in the footer, and verify its authenticity on the regulator's official website. Beyond just possessing a license, the jurisdiction itself matters; some regulators have more stringent requirements than others, providing a higher level of protection to players.
The Importance of Third-Party Audits
Licensing is a foundational step, but it's not the only measure of a casino's integrity. Reputable casinos also undergo regular audits by independent third-party organizations, such as e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ance). These audits assess the fairness of the casino's games, ensuring that the Random Number Generators (RNGs) are truly random and that the payout percentages align with published figures. These certifications demonstrate a commitment to transparency and player protection. Furthermore, audits extend beyond game fairness to include the casino's security protocols, verifying that sensitive player data is protected through encryption and other security measures. Looking for the eCOGRA seal of approval or similar certifications is a strong indicator of a trustworthy online casino.

The Rise of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games have revolutionized the online casino experience, bridging the gap between online and brick-and-mortar casinos. These games feature real human dealers streamed live via HD video, allowing players to interact with the dealer and other players in real-time. Popular live dealer games include live blackjack, live roulette, live baccarat, and live poker variations. The immersive nature of live dealer games replicates the atmosphere of a traditional casino, offering a more social and engaging experience. The convenience of playing from home combined with the authenticity of a live dealer environment has made these games incredibly popular among online casino enthusiasts. Understanding Wagering Requirements
Many online casinos off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ward loyal customers. However, it’s crucial to understand the wagering requirements associated with these bonuses.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ings earned from the b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means the player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before being eligible for a withdrawal. Players should carefully review the terms and conditions of any bonus offer to ensure they understand the wagering requirements and can realistically meet them. Failure to meet the wagering requirements will result in the for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ings. Comparing bonus offers and their associated terms across different casinos is a smart strategy.

Customer Support and Responsible Gambling
Responsive and helpful customer support is vital for addressing any issues or concerns that players may encounter. The best online casinos offer multiple support channels, including live chat, email, and phone support. Live chat is particularly valuable as it provides instant assistance. The support team should be knowledgeable, professional, and readily available to assist players with their inquiries. A casino that demonstrates a commitment to customer satisfaction is a good sign. Equally important is a commitment to responsible gambling. Reputable casinos provide t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and links to problem gambling support organizations. Promoting responsible gambling and protecting vulnerable players is a fundamental ethical obligation.
Beyond simply offering these tools, effective casinos proactively encourage players to utilize them and raise awareness about the risks of problem gambling. They often provide access to self-assessment questionnaires and educational materials. A responsible approach to gambling fosters a safe and enjoyable environment for all players, solidifying a casino's reputation for integrity and player care.
